Overview
This brief overview of complementary and alternative medicine (CAM) and integrative medicine (IM) will offer food for thought and practical information as the US healthcare system continues its evolution into one that promotes high value care in part by incorporating CAM/IM strategies and modalities that have good evidence.
Learning Objectives
- Recognize that complementary and alternative medicine (CAM)/integrative medicine (IM) is much more than a collection of treatment modalities not taught traditionally in medical school with potential to contribute positively to the ongoing drive towards value-based healthcare
- Review the evidence supporting the use of acupuncture for various pain and non-pain conditions
- Describe the breadth and depth of benefit of various mind/body strategies in improving and maintaining health
- Summarize how to discuss supplements and herbs, especially those with best evidence for their use, with patients
